Horizon Quantum Holdings Ltd. is bolstering its European presence with the deployment of a 256-qubit trapped-ion system at its Dublin headquarters, marking the company's second hardware testbed location. This sixth-generation system, developed by IonQ, boasts a chip-based design and will be housed at the facility in Ireland. The expansion is supported by Ireland's National Semiconductor Strategy and IDA Ireland, underscoring the country's commitment to advancing quantum computing capabilities. The 256-qubit system's placement in Ireland is significant, as it will enable researchers to explore new applications and use cases for quantum computing1.
